Foggy Fireworks



Anyone who knows me knows that I'm an insane fireworks junkie.  Living in Orlando allows me to see high quality shows on a regular basis.... to the point where I can tell when things change.

Alas sometimes, mother nature plays havoc.  Usually December yields great weather for fireworks - low humidity and strong breezes to blow the smoke away.... sadly in the photo above, not quite the case.  A horribly thick bank of fog rolled into the area just as I pulled up.  Knowing the show i was about to photograph, I decided to make the best of a bad situation and try and use the fog to my advantage.

This is the finale of their Holiday Wishes show. Slightly overexposed. But i love how the fireworks just open above the clouds....
